Time smoking a picture mb-code BE030259 In the foreground is one'Time smoking a picture', 1761. Subtitled 'As Statues moulder into Worth', a comment on the 18th century idea that decay and patina were somehow evidence of genuine origin and true age. Illustration from Social Caricature in the Eighteenth Century With over two hundred illustrations by George Paston [pseudonym of Emily Morse Symonds], (London, 1905).
